Older grownups may additionally need aid with individual treatment. This includes everyday activities, likewise called "activities of daily living," such as bathing, dressing, grooming, using the bathroom, eating, and moving for example, rising and right into a chair. To provide assistance for individual care, a family member, buddy, or trained aide might help momentarily daily.
Medicare, Medicaid, and personal wellness insurance policy typically do not cover these services. Some long-lasting treatment insurance coverage intends aid pay for buddy brows through.

If the older adult demands aid with tasks such as paying costs and submitting medical insurance types, you or a relied on relative could assist.
One way to do this is with a power of attorney, which permits a relied on family member or friend to make economic decisions on their part. That individual might help handle lenders, pay costs from the older individual's checking account, or learn about Social Safety or Medicare advantages. Friendly site visitors are nonmedical assistants who supply friendship and some supervision for a few hours. They do not generally supply any type of housekeeping or personal treatment solutions. Home health assistants or individual treatment aides supply standard healthcare and personal treatment such as showering, clothing, and help in operation the commode.
Residential treatment or retirement community are special apartment building or exclusive homes that offer supportive settings yet enable locals to continue to be somewhat independent. Locals have their own houses or rooms. Some facilities offer dishes in a central place and use a selection of services, such as laundry, housekeeping, and aid with showering, dressing, and taking medications.
